Jump to content

ثيم معين ما يحترق من النار


Recommended Posts

-- Client Side !

addEventHandler ( "onClientPlayerDamage", localPlayer, 
    function ( ) 
        for _, v in ipairs ( getPlayersInTeam ( getTeamFromName ( "اسم التيم" ) ) ) do 
            if ( source == v ) then 
                cancelEvent ( ) 
            end 
        end 
    end 
) 

Link to comment
-- Client Side !
addEventHandler ( "onClientPlayerDamage", localPlayer, 
    function ( ) 
        for _, v in ipairs ( getPlayersInTeam ( getTeamFromName ( "اسم التيم" ) ) ) do 
            if ( source == v ) then 
                cancelEvent ( ) 
            end 
        end 
    end 
) 

ماظن كودك راح يضبط

localPlayer هو نفسه source الا اذا صار

localPlayer لان حسب علمي انك ما تقدر تلغي الضرر الا للاعب

Link to comment
-- Client Side !
addEventHandler ( "onClientPlayerDamage", localPlayer, 
    function ( ) 
        for _, v in ipairs ( getPlayersInTeam ( getTeamFromName ( "اسم التيم" ) ) ) do 
            if ( source == v ) then 
                cancelEvent ( ) 
            end 
        end 
    end 
) 

ماظن كودك راح يضبط

localPlayer هو نفسه source الا اذا صار

localPlayer لان حسب علمي انك ما تقدر تلغي الضرر الا للاعب

السكربت في الكلنت + السورس هنا هو اللاعب(لوكال بلير) والكانسل ايفنت متوفرة لهلحدث مثل ما يقول الويكي

Link to comment

!طيب ليش تجيب كل اللاعبين الي في التيم؟

+

ذا الكود بيلغي كل الضرر

هو يبي ما يحترق من النار فقط

addEventHandler("onClientPlayerDamage", localPlayer, 
function(_, wp) 
    if (wp == 37) and (getPlayerTeam(source) == getTeamFromName("اسم التيم")) then 
        cancelEvent() 
    end 
end) 

setTeamFriendlyFire و إذا كنت تستخدم الفنكشن

راح يسبب لك مشكلة، الأفنت ما راح يجيه ترقير إذا كان سبب الدمج نار

و ذا بسبب بق في أم تي أي

Link to comment
!طيب ليش تجيب كل اللاعبين الي في التيم؟

+

ذا الكود بيلغي كل الضرر

هو يبي ما يحترق من النار فقط

addEventHandler("onClientPlayerDamage", localPlayer, 
function(_, wp) 
    if (wp == 37) and (getPlayerTeam(source) == getTeamFromName("اسم التيم")) then 
        cancelEvent() 
    end 
end) 

setTeamFriendlyFire و إذا كنت تستخدم الفنكشن

راح يسبب لك مشكلة، الأفنت ما راح يجيه ترقير إذا كان سبب الدمج نار

و ذا بسبب بق في أم تي أي

كلام سليم والله

100%

Link to comment
!طيب ليش تجيب كل اللاعبين الي في التيم؟

+

ذا الكود بيلغي كل الضرر

هو يبي ما يحترق من النار فقط

addEventHandler("onClientPlayerDamage", localPlayer, 
function(_, wp) 
    if (wp == 37) and (getPlayerTeam(source) == getTeamFromName("اسم التيم")) then 
        cancelEvent() 
    end 
end) 

setTeamFriendlyFire و إذا كنت تستخدم الفنكشن

راح يسبب لك مشكلة، الأفنت ما راح يجيه ترقير إذا كان سبب الدمج نار

و ذا بسبب بق في أم تي أي

بس بهالحالة لو ماكان اللاعب في تيم ، ممكن يصير خطأ ويسوي كانسل للإيفنت لما يحترق اللاعب .. لانكـ مو متحقق اذا كان اللاعب بـ تيم ..

يصير كذآ ,

addEventHandler ( "onClientPlayerDamage", localPlayer, 
    function( _, wp ) 
        if ( wp == 37 ) and ( getPlayerTeam ( source ) ) and ( getPlayerTeam ( source ) == getTeamFromName ( "1" ) ) then 
            cancelEvent ( ) 
        end 
    end 
) 

Link to comment
!طيب ليش تجيب كل اللاعبين الي في التيم؟

+

ذا الكود بيلغي كل الضرر

هو يبي ما يحترق من النار فقط

addEventHandler("onClientPlayerDamage", localPlayer, 
function(_, wp) 
    if (wp == 37) and (getPlayerTeam(source) == getTeamFromName("اسم التيم")) then 
        cancelEvent() 
    end 
end) 

setTeamFriendlyFire و إذا كنت تستخدم الفنكشن

راح يسبب لك مشكلة، الأفنت ما راح يجيه ترقير إذا كان سبب الدمج نار

و ذا بسبب بق في أم تي أي

مشكور

Link to comment

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...